On your home page ..... the animation of the orb .... the original picture is sized 125 x 122 pixels but you have yours set for 157 x 153 - so it has distorted the animation and highlighted the jaggie edges.
On entering the main site ..... the one thing that "shouted at me" was the text being all in capital letters - that is sort of the equivalent of "shouting" and the white against the black background - especially when in upper case - hit my eyes rather hard. For me, I would prefer less contrast in the colours and lower case instead of upper .... but that is just my opinion.
